A Tale of Two Giants: Apple Inc. vs. Take-Two Interactive Software, Inc.

In the ever-evolving landscape of technology and entertainment, Apple Inc. and Take-Two Interactive Software, Inc. stand as titans in their respective domains. From 2014 to 2024, Apple has consistently demonstrated its prowess, with gross profits soaring by approximately 156%, reaching a staggering $180 billion in 2024. This growth underscores Apple's dominance in the tech industry, driven by innovative products and a loyal customer base.

Conversely, Take-Two Interactive, a leader in the gaming industry, has seen its gross profits grow by nearly 140% over the same period, peaking at $2.24 billion in 2024. This growth reflects the increasing popularity of gaming and Take-Two's ability to captivate audiences with blockbuster titles.

While Apple's financial scale dwarfs that of Take-Two, both companies exemplify success in their fields, driven by innovation and consumer engagement.
